Relief for Nigerians as Dangote slashes petrol price

Dangote Petroleum Refinery has reduced the ex-depot price of Premium Motor Spirit (PMS), commonly known as petrol, by N75 per litre, offering fresh hope of lower pump prices for consumers across Nigeria.

The price adjustment, announced in a circular to fuel marketers on Monday, follows the easing of geopolitical tensions in the Middle East, which had driven up global crude oil prices and fuel costs over the past three months.

Under the new pricing structure, the refinery’s gantry price has been reduced from N1,250 per litre to N1,175 per litre. The coastal price per metric tonne has also been cut from N1,595,790 to N1,495,215.

Dangote Refinery said the revised rates took effect from midnight on June 16, adding that all outstanding unloaded gantry volumes would be repriced accordingly.
